fan: Move fan code to extras directory
The print cooling fan and printer heater_fan are independent modules that can reside in the extras directory. Signed-off-by: Kevin O'Connor <kevin@koconnor.net>

+# Printer cooling fan
+#
+# Copyright (C) 2016-2018 Kevin O'Connor <kevin@koconnor.net>
+#
+# This file may be distributed under the terms of the GNU GPLv3 license.
+import pins
+
+FAN_MIN_TIME = 0.1
+PWM_CYCLE_TIME = 0.010
+
+class PrinterFan:
+ def __init__(self, config):
+ self.last_fan_value = 0.
+ self.last_fan_time = 0.
+ self.max_power = config.getfloat('max_power', 1., above=0., maxval=1.)
+ self.kick_start_time = config.getfloat('kick_start_time', 0.1, minval=0.)
+ printer = config.get_printer()
+ self.mcu_fan = pins.setup_pin(printer, 'pwm', config.get('pin'))
+ self.mcu_fan.setup_max_duration(0.)
+ self.mcu_fan.setup_cycle_time(PWM_CYCLE_TIME)
+ self.mcu_fan.setup_hard_pwm(config.getint('hard_pwm', 0))
+ def set_speed(self, print_time, value):
+ value = max(0., min(self.max_power, value))
+ if value == self.last_fan_value:
+ return
+ print_time = max(self.last_fan_time + FAN_MIN_TIME, print_time)
+ if (value and value < self.max_power
+ and not self.last_fan_value and self.kick_start_time):
+ # Run fan at full speed for specified kick_start_time
+ self.mcu_fan.set_pwm(print_time, self.max_power)
+ print_time += self.kick_start_time
+ self.mcu_fan.set_pwm(print_time, value)
+ self.last_fan_time = print_time
+ self.last_fan_value = value
+
+def load_config(config):
+ if config.get_name() != 'fan':
+ raise config.error("Invalid print cooling fan config name")
+ return PrinterFan(config)

+# Support fans that are enabled when a heater is on
+#
+# Copyright (C) 2016-2018 Kevin O'Connor <kevin@koconnor.net>
+#
+# This file may be distributed under the terms of the GNU GPLv3 license.
+import fan, extruder
+
+PIN_MIN_TIME = 0.100
+
+class PrinterHeaterFan:
+ def __init__(self, config):
+ self.printer = config.get_printer()
+ self.heater_name = config.get("heater", "extruder0")
+ self.heater_temp = config.getfloat("heater_temp", 50.0)
+ self.fan = fan.PrinterFan(config)
+ self.mcu = self.fan.mcu_fan.get_mcu()
+ max_power = self.fan.max_power
+ self.fan_speed = config.getfloat(
+ "fan_speed", max_power, minval=0., maxval=max_power)
+ self.fan.mcu_fan.setup_start_value(0., max_power)
+ def printer_state(self, state):
+ if state == 'ready':
+ self.heater = extruder.get_printer_heater(
+ self.printer, self.heater_name)
+ reactor = self.printer.get_reactor()
+ reactor.register_timer(self.callback, reactor.NOW)
+ def callback(self, eventtime):
+ current_temp, target_temp = self.heater.get_temp(eventtime)
+ power = 0.
+ if target_temp or current_temp > self.heater_temp:
+ power = self.fan_speed
+ print_time = self.mcu.estimated_print_time(eventtime) + PIN_MIN_TIME
+ self.fan.set_speed(print_time, power)
+ return eventtime + 1.
+
+def load_config(config):
+ return PrinterHeaterFan(config)
